About Evdokia Kadi

Evdokia Kadi (Greek: Ευδοκία Καδή; born 1981 in Nicosia, Cyprus) is a Greek-Cypriot singer who represented Cyprus at the Eurovision Song Contest 2008, with the song "Femme Fatale". She was eliminated in the second semi-final on May 22 and therefore did not make it to the final. She started her singing career in 2001 at the University of Cyprus. Since then, she has taken part in many concerts in Cyprus and abroad alongside several Greek and Cypriot singers and performers.
